perf cs-etm: Print auxtrace info even if OpenCSD isn't linked
Printing the info doesn't have any dependency on OpenCSD, and neither
does recording Coresight data. Because it's sometimes useful to look at
the info for debugging, it makes sense to be able to see it on the same
platform that the recording was made on.
So pull the auxtrace info printing parts into a new file that is always
compiled into Perf.
